A stunning, cabinet-sized radial cluster of highly lustrous, colorless to green, cubically-tipped apophyllite crystals, from a now infamous find of 2001. You simply cannot get them on the market, any more. These have a special place in the midst of other Indian minerals and some people call them "disco balls" for good reason. They sparkle incredibly in person. The "tail" of pearlescent stilbite blades and a ball of scolecite are fine accents.
